Feature Comparison

FeatureSporttradeGood Judgment Open
Settlement MechanismRegulated exchangeAdmin resolution
Trading ModelOrder book (exchange)Forecast tournament (no money)
Collateral TokenUSDNone (Brier score)
Min Trade$1N/A
Api Access
Embeddable Odds
Geo RestrictionsLicensed US states onlyNone
Market CreationExchange-approvedPlatform-set
